Naira gains marginally, exchanges at 441.25 to dollar

On Monday, the Naira appreciated a little bit against the dollar, reaching N441.25 at the Investors and Exporters window.

Compared to the N441.38 it exchanged for the dollar before the close of business on October 14, the amount represented a slight increase of 0.03 percent.

According to NAN, the open indicative rate on Monday closed at N439.63 to the dollar.

Meanwhile, an exchange rate of N442.50 to the dollar was the highest rate recorded within the day’s trading before it settled at N441.25.

In the day’s trading, the Naira was sold for as low as N425 to the dollar.

A total of 46.21 million was traded in foreign exchange at the official investors and exporters window on Monday.
